Apple cider vinegar (ACV) is valued for its acidic nature, primarily due to acetic acid, which helps balance scalp pH. It’s rich in B vitamins, vitamin C, and minerals that promote hair health. ACV also has “antimicrobial properties, which can help combat scalp infections and dandruff.”

To prepare for an overnight hair treatment, mix one part ACV with two parts water to avoid irritation. Apply the solution to the scalp, ensuring even coverage. Let it sit overnight, protecting your pillow with a towel. Rinse thoroughly in the morning.
